ROLE SUMMARY:
The incumbent will oversee the efficient processing, tracking, and reconciling of all logistical records associated with the site's shipping warehouse.
D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ES (*denotes essential functions):
- *Processing order transactions through an electronic warehousing manage ment system (WMS) and reconciling against records created in SAP.
- *Tracking and verifying bills of lading for both internal transfers of products and external shipments.
- *Monitoring the inventory of hundreds of SKUs for upcoming orders; and tracking and ensuring accurate schedules are prepared and implemented.

MINIMUM EDUCATION, TRAINING, AND EXPERIENCE REQUIREMENTS:
- High school diploma or equivalent.
- 3 years of related experience OR
- 2 years of post-secondary degree (with or without degree) in related discipline and 1 year of related experience.
PREFERED EDUCATION, TRAINING, AND EXPERIENCE REQUIREMENTS:
- Preference will be given to candidates with applicable shipping and/or logistical recordkeeping experience, and proficiency with SAP and Microsoft Office.
- Associate or bachelor’s degree in a relevant field.
K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, AND ABILITIES:
- Proficiency in entering and analyzing data within WMS and SAP systems.
- Ability to reconcile discrepancies between different data records.
- Strong attention to detail for tracking bills of lading and monitoring inventory levels.
- Precision in scheduling and verifying shipping details.
- Ability to identify and resolve issues related to order processing and inventory discrepancies.
- Communication:
- Effective communication skills to coordinate with internal teams and external partners.
- Ability to provide clear and accurate information on shipping schedules and order statuses.
- Ability to manage multiple tasks simultaneously, such as processing transactions and tracking shipments.
- Strong organizational abilities to keep track of numerous SKUs and shipping schedules.
